Skip to content

JMessage's Flutter plugin (Android & iOS). 极光推送官方支持的 Flutter 插件(Android & iOS)。

License

Notifications You must be signed in to change notification settings

jpush/jmessage-flutter-plugin

Folders and files

NameName
Last commit message
Last commit date

Latest commit

f19f8a0 · Jul 6, 2022
Mar 30, 2021
Apr 30, 2019
Jul 6, 2022
Jul 23, 2019
Jul 6, 2022
Oct 29, 2021
Jul 6, 2022
May 25, 2021
Jul 6, 2022
Aug 22, 2019
Jul 6, 2022
Jan 8, 2020
May 25, 2021
Jul 6, 2022

Repository files navigation

QQ Group pub package

jmessage_flutter

安装

在工程 pubspec.yaml 中加入 dependencies

//github 集成  
dependencies:
  jmessage_flutter:
    git:
      url: git://github.com/jpush/jmessage-flutter-plugin.git
      ref: master

//pub.dev 集成
dependencies:
  jmessage_flutter: 2.2.1

配置

/android/app/build.gradle 中添加下列代码:

android {
    ......
    defaultConfig {
        applicationId "com.xxx.xxx" //JPush上注册的包名.
        ......

        ndk {
            //选择要添加的对应cpu类型的.so库。
            abiFilters 'armeabi', 'armeabi-v7a', 'armeabi-v8a'
            // 还可以添加 'x86', 'x86_64', 'mips', 'mips64'
        }

        manifestPlaceholders = [
            JPUSH_PKGNAME : applicationId,
            JPUSH_APPKEY : "你的appkey", //JPush上注册的包名对应的appkey.
            JPUSH_CHANNEL : "developer-default", //暂时填写默认值即可.
        ]
        ......
    }
    ......
}

使用

import 'package:jmessage_flutter/jmessage_flutter.dart';

APIs

注意 : 需要先调用 JmessageFlutter().init 来初始化插件,才能保证其它功能正常工作。

参考

About

JMessage's Flutter plugin (Android & iOS). 极光推送官方支持的 Flutter 插件(Android & iOS)。

https://docs.jiguang.cn

Topics

Resources

License

Stars

Watchers

Forks

Packages

No packages published